National Library of #Medicine ⚕️ : In case of #SPE ☀️ occurrence for Intra-Vehicular Activities (IVA) outside a #RadiationShelter, dose reductions to BFO in the range of 44-57% 📉 are demonstrated to be achievable with the #spacesuit designs made only of water 💦 elements, or of multi-layer protection elements (with a thin layer of a high density material covering the water filled volume) https://pubmed.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/29198316/

#wearable #RadiationProtection #spacesuit #HumanSpaceflightHealth

Exploring innovative radiation shielding approaches in space: A material and design study for a wearable radiation protection spacesuit - PubMed

We present a design study for a wearable radiation-shielding spacesuit, designed to protect astronauts' most radiosensitive organs. The suit could be used in an emergency, to perform necessary interventions outside a radiation shelter in the space habitat in case of a Solar Proton Event (SPE). A wea …

On #Earth, 2.4 mSv is normal. Above 100 mSv, cancer is likely. People on the #ISS face levels of 200 mSv, and #interplanetary levels of #radiation ☢️ are around 600 mSv. Researchers speculate that travel to #Mars 🔴 could involve a 30% risk of #cancer.
#Metals, including #lead and #aluminum, would make poor shields 🛡️ in #DeepSpace https://www.medicalnewstoday.com/articles/308764
